Time Out

Geneva coffee – The best cafés in Geneva

Tucked on a grassy patch near the Brunswick monument on the right bank of Lake Geneva, it’s a cosy cabin designed as a home from home. Inside there are old wooden dressers containing books and magazines, paintings on the walls, mismatched lamps and trinkets. Outside, the leafy terrace looking onto the monument and the lake is a peaceful spot to sit and have a quiet breakfast or lunch – the large salads are particularly tasty.

Trimm Travels

Where To Stay and Eat in Geneva, Switzerland

Cottage Cafe is located right across the street from the Le Richemond. It has an interesting history. They originally used the cafe as temporary housing from 1876-1879 for the workers charged with the task of building the Brunswick Monument.
